Blogs have taken the Internet by storm, and they're the easiest way to publish your brilliant thoughts. Basically, a Blog  is an interactive, personalized Web journal for posting your views, art, rants, raves, reviews, pictures, music-anything that you want to share with the teaming masses.
Many blogs provide commentary or news on a particular subject; others function as more personal online diaries. A typical blog combines text, images, and links to other blogs, web pages, and other media related to its topic. The ability for readers to leave comments in an interactive format is an important part of many blogs. Most blogs are primarily textual, although some focus on art , photographs photoblog, sketchblog, videos , music MP3 blog, audio podcasting and are part of a wider network of social media. Micro-blogging is another type of blogging which consists of blogs with very short posts.
Bloggers will often link to other blogs and websites as a way of illustrating a point or citing a source. This not only adds an air of credibility to the blog, but it also allows readers to visit blogs they might not have otherwise heard about. The blogger on the other end of the link is sure to appreciate the resulting boom in traffic. In fact a community made up of like-minded bloggers and commentary usually forms as a result of the links. These bloggers will cite each other's blogs in their own and even discuss and analyze each other's topics.

  Weblogs, often simply called blogs, are web pages that contain newsgroup-like articles in a chronological order with the newest article listed first. Postings to blogs are frequent, typically once a day. They are usually produced by one author or by a small group of authors and are open to the public for reading.

Blog communities give people a place where they can meet online and discuss topics that they share an interest in. they do this by using blogs to talk with each other and relay important information. A blog can be about anything you want to talk about. For instance, it could be about religion, politics, teens, retirement, vacation spots or even knitting. If you are interested in using blogs to discuss topics with others these tips for starting blog communities can help you begin. The topics are endless and only limited by your own imagination and you will find that having a blog community can be rewarding in many ways.

  Begin creating your blog community by choosing a topic. This is a very important step because it must be something that you are truly interested in and something that others will find interesting as well. remember to not stray away from the topic you choose and always provide good content that you keep updated on a regularly bases. If you fail to do this, then your loyal visitors will begin to lose interest in your blog community. This is necessary to keep your visitors interested and coming back for more. You will need to search for ways that can help increase the traffic to your site to help bring in more visitors.

  Social media provides an excellent opportunity for freelance bloggers to promote their writing and draw traffic and exposure. Many paid writers assume their job is over as soon as the post is submitted. However, a little bit of extra effort to promote that post with social media could make a world of difference in the success of the post and in the amount or work that you get. Blog owners are paying for results. If you can outperform other freelance bloggers by delivering some extra traffic with social media, your services will be more complete and more effective.
